Is there a way to increase tinydb JSON limit?

I have a tinydb json file but I noticed that at a certain point it refuses to write more items to the json file and throws an error while parsing because it cut off in the middle of writing an item

This is the traceback. It shows the json parser failing to parse because the writer cut off writing in the middle of an item

The reason this happened was because multiple threads were writing to the db file at the same time so I ended up manually writing to multiple files: one for every entry
